Structural engineer services involve assessing, designing, and analyzing the structural components of buildings and other structures to ensure their stability and safety. These services typically include evaluating existing structures for potential issues, providing detailed plans for modifications or repairs, and developing new structural designs that meet safety standards. By focusing on the integrity of load-bearing elements such as foundations, beams, and columns, structural engineers help prevent failures and ensure that structures can withstand various stresses and forces.
These services are essential in addressing problems related to structural damage, deterioration, or design flaws. Common issues include foundation settling, cracks in walls or floors, and signs of structural fatigue. When property owners notice such concerns, a structural engineer can identify the root causes and recommend appropriate solutions. This helps mitigate risks associated with structural failure, which can lead to costly repairs or safety hazards. Structural engineers also assist in planning renovations or additions, ensuring that new construction integrates seamlessly with existing structures without compromising stability.

Design Fees - Structural engineering design services typically range from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the project's complexity. For example, a small home addition may cost around $1,200, while a large commercial project could be closer to $4,500.
Per-Project Costs - Many structural engineers charge a flat fee for specific projects, which can vary from $2,000 to $10,000. A residential foundation assessment might be around $2,500, whereas a full building analysis could reach $9,000 or more.
Hourly Rates - Hourly charges for structural engineering services generally fall between $100 and $200 per hour. For instance, a detailed structural review may take 15 hours, totaling approximately $1,500 to $3,000.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include site inspections, report preparation, or revisions, often adding $500 to $2,000 to the overall project. These fees vary based on the scope and location of the work in Dolton, IL and surrounding are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
